Abstract

The invention provides an oil-in-water skin care emulsion containing a sialylate and a preparation method thereof. The present invention applies a sialylate to an oil-in-water system to solve the problem of degradation of sialic acid and the problem of reduced viscosity of thickeners, especially carbomer-containing thickeners. According to the invention, through a large amount of researches on the emulsifier and the thickener of the skin care milk, the sialylate can stably exist in the obtained oil-in-water system, and the obtained skin care milk has excellent physical and chemical stability and remarkably improves the quality of cosmetics.

Background
Sialic acid (Sialic acid) is an acidic amino sugar containing 9 carbon atoms and having a pyranose structure, also known as N-acetylneuraminic acid, cubilose acid and cubilose element, widely exists in various biological tissues, is an important part forming a cell surface complex carbohydrate, and has physiological effects of promoting brain development, improving memory, resisting inflammation, viruses and tumors, improving the absorption of vitamins and minerals by intestinal tracts and the like. With the intensive research and understanding of sialic acid, sialic acid also inhibits the oxidation of tyrosine, reduces melanin deposition and thus improves the appearance of skin. Therefore, sialic acid can be widely used in the cosmetic field.
The oil-in-water (O/W) system is one of the most commonly used emulsification systems for topical cream emulsions, and is an emulsification system in which an oil is dispersed in water, the oil being the internal phase and the water being the continuous external phase. The oil-in-water system has the advantages of simple operation, fresh skin feeling and the like, and is the most common preparation formulation of cosmetics.
However, the applicant finds that when sialic acid is applied to an oil-in-water system, the thickening body (particularly the thickening body containing carbomer) has the problems of gravity stratification, particle flocculation and agglomeration when the thickening body is matched with partial auxiliary materials, and also finds that the sialic acid is subjected to degradation reaction in the oil-in-water system, so that the content of the sialic acid in the system is reduced, and meanwhile, the generated by-products cause the problem of discoloration of the system, and the quality of a cosmetic product is seriously reduced.
In view of this, the invention is particularly proposed.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to solve the problems in the prior art, the invention aims to provide an oil-in-water type skin care milk containing a sialylate, which has excellent physical and chemical stability and remarkably improves the quality of cosmetics. The invention also provides a preparation method of the oil-in-water skin care emulsion containing the sialic acid salt.
In order to achieve the above object, the first aspect of the present invention provides an oil-in-water skin care emulsion containing a sialylate, wherein the sialylate is used as the only functional ingredient or one of the functional ingredients.
The invention discovers that the sialic acid salt formed by neutralizing sialic acid with alkali has obviously improved stability to acid, heat, light and the like, and when the sialic acid salt is added into an oil-in-water system as a unique functional component or one of the functional components, the problem that the sialic acid reduces the viscosity of a thickening body (particularly a thickening body containing carbomer) can be effectively solved, and the stability of the skin care milk is improved.
In some specific embodiments, the oil-in-water skin care milk includes a sialylate and an emulsifier.
Further, the weight percentage content of the sialic acid salt in the oil-in-water skin care milk is 0.1-2%; the weight percentage of the emulsifier in the oil-in-water skin care milk is 4-13%.
In some particular embodiments, the sialylate is selected from one or more of sodium sialylate, potassium sialylate, calcium sialylate, magnesium sialylate.
Further, the emulsifier comprises the following components in a weight ratio of (2-5): (1-5): steareth-21, steareth-2 and cetearyl alcohol of (1-3). The invention further discovers that the skin care emulsion adopting the emulsifier has no layering phenomenon, is more favorable for improving the physical stability of a system, and simultaneously has stable sialylate, is not easy to generate degradation reaction, and is further more favorable for improving the chemical stability of the system.
In some specific embodiments, the oil-in-water skin care emulsion further comprises 0.15-6 wt% of a thickening agent.
Further, the thickener comprises the following components in a weight ratio (0.05-1): (0.1-5) carbomer and polyacrylamide. Carbomer is a common thickener in cosmetics and a very important rheology regulator, can form gel to achieve good stability and use feeling, and is widely applied to preparation of creams and emulsions. However, in the process of the invention, the carbomer is compatible with the sialic acid, and a flocculation reaction is generated. The present invention employs a sialylate to avoid this phenomenon. The skin care milk adopting the thickener has excellent physical and chemical stability, and meanwhile, the obtained skin care milk has better skin feel so as to further meet the requirements of consumers.
In some specific embodiments, the oil-in-water skin care emulsion further comprises 10-40 wt% of an oil emollient selected from one or more of isooctyl palmitate, polydimethylsiloxane, petrolatum, and squalane. Wherein the petrolatum is vaseline.
Furthermore, the oil-in-water type skin care emulsion also comprises the following components in percentage by weight: 0.1-5% of skin repairing agent, 0.1-20% of humectant, 0.1-1% of preservative and/or 0.1-2% of acid-base regulator.
In some specific embodiments, the skin repair agent is allantoin;
and/or the humectant is propylene glycol;
and/or the preservative is p-hydroxyacetophenone;
and/or the pH regulator is sodium carbonate.
In some specific embodiments, the oil-in-water skin care lotion comprises the following raw materials in percentage by weight: 0.1-2% of sialic acid salt, 212-5% of steareth-212%, 21-5% of steareth, 1-3% of cetearyl alcohol, 2-10% of isooctyl palmitate, 2-10% of polydimethylsiloxane, 5-10% of petrolatum, 1-10% of squalane, 0.1-20% of propylene glycol, 0.1-5% of allantoin, 0.05-1% of carbomer, 0.1-5% of polyacrylamide, 0.1-2% of sodium carbonate, 0.1-1% of p-hydroxyacetophenone and the balance of deionized water.
In a second aspect of the present invention, there is provided a method for preparing the aforementioned oil-in-water type skin care emulsion containing a sialylate, comprising the steps of:
(1) weighing the components according to the weight percentage for later use;
(2) sequentially adding thickener, moisturizer and deionized water into a vacuum emulsifying pot, heating in water bath to 75-85 deg.C under stirring, and keeping the temperature for 10-15 min;
(3) sequentially adding emulsifier and oil emollient into oil phase pan, stirring, heating in water bath to 75-85 deg.C, and keeping the temperature for 10-15 min;
(4) adding the materials in the oil phase pot into a vacuum emulsifying pot, homogenizing at 10000-15000rpm for 10-15min until a uniform emulsified body is formed, continuing stirring, adding the sialylate, the skin repairing agent, the acid-base regulator and the preservative when the temperature is reduced to 40-45 ℃, observing the uniformity of the material body, and cooling to room temperature to discharge.
The invention has the following advantages:
the invention applies the sialic acid salt to an oil-in-water system, and solves the problem that the degradation of sialic acid and the reduction of viscosity of a thickening body (particularly a thickening body containing carbomer) cause the instability of the system. According to the invention, through a large amount of researches on the emulsifier and the thickener of the skin care emulsion, the sialylate can stably exist in the obtained oil-in-water system, and the obtained skin care emulsion has excellent physical and chemical stability and good skin feel, so that the quality of cosmetics is remarkably improved.
Detailed Description
The following examples are intended to illustrate the invention but are not intended to limit the scope of the invention. The examples do not show the specific techniques or conditions, according to the technical or conditions described in the literature in the field, or according to the product specifications. The reagents or instruments used are conventional products available from regular distributors, not indicated by the manufacturer.
In the following examples and comparative examples, "%" means weight percent, unless otherwise specified.
Example 1
The embodiment provides an oil-in-water skin care emulsion containing a sialylate, which comprises the following components in percentage by weight: 1% of sodium sialate, 214.2% of steareth-21%, 3% of cetearyl alcohol, 5% of isooctyl palmitate, 2.2% of polydimethylsiloxane, 10% of petrolatum, 10% of squalane, 12% of propylene glycol, 1.5% of allantoin, 0.6% of carbomer, 2% of polyacrylamide, 0.5% of sodium carbonate, 0.5% of p-hydroxyacetophenone and the balance of deionized water.
The preparation method of the oil-in-water type skin care milk comprises the following steps:
(1) weighing the raw materials according to the weight percentage for later use;
(2) sequentially adding carbomer, polyacrylamide, propylene glycol and deionized water into a vacuum emulsifying pot, heating to 80 ℃ in a water bath under the stirring condition, and keeping the temperature for 12 min;
(3) adding steareth-21, steareth-2, glyceryl stearate, PEG-100 stearate, cetostearyl alcohol, isooctyl palmitate, polydimethylsiloxane, petrolatum, and squalane into an oil phase pot in sequence, heating to 80 deg.C in water bath under stirring, and keeping the temperature for 15 min;
(4) adding the materials in the oil phase pot into a vacuum emulsifying pot, homogenizing at 12000rpm for 10min until a uniform emulsified body is formed, continuing stirring, cooling to 40 deg.C, adding sialylate, allantoin, sodium carbonate, and p-hydroxyacetophenone, observing the uniformity of the material body, and cooling to room temperature to obtain the final product.

Example 6
The present example is different from example 1 only in the thickening agent used, and the oil-in-water skin care emulsion of the present example includes 2% of carbomer and 0.6% of polyacrylamide.
The preparation method of the skin care cream of this example is the same as that of example 1.
Comparative example 1
This comparative example differs from example 1 only in that the emulsifier used is different and steareth-21 in example 1 is replaced with an equivalent amount of PEG-100 stearate.
The skin care milk of this comparative example was prepared in the same manner as in example 1.
Comparative example 2
This comparative example differs from example 1 only in that the emulsifier used is different and steareth-21 in example 1 is replaced by an equivalent amount of glyceryl stearate.
The skin care milk of this comparative example was prepared in the same manner as in example 1.
Comparative example 3
The comparative example differs from example 1 only in the emulsifiers used, including steareth-210.6%, steareth-25%, cetearyl alcohol 2.5%
The skin care milk of this comparative example was prepared in the same manner as in example 1.
Comparative example 4
This comparative example differs from example 1 only in that the thickening agent used is different, the polyacrylamide in example 1 being replaced by an equal amount of xanthan gum.
The skin care milk of this comparative example was prepared in the same manner as in example 1.
Test example 1
The oil-in-water type skin care milk of the present invention was tested for high temperature stability and long term stability.
High-temperature stability: the skin-care milks of examples 1-6 and comparative examples 1-4 were respectively placed in suitable containers, placed in a constant-temperature drying oven at 50 ℃ for 10 days, and sampled at 0 th, 5 th and 10 th days, respectively, to examine the properties, the content of sialylate and the pH of the skin-care milks.
Long-term stability: the skin care milks of examples 1 to 6 and comparative examples 1 to 4 were placed in suitable containers, respectively, in a constant temperature drying oven at (28 ± 2) ° c for 12 months, and samples were taken at the end of 0, 3, 6, 9, and 12 months, respectively, to examine the properties, the content of sialylate, and the pH of the skin care milks.
The test results for high temperature stability and long term stability are shown in table 1.
TABLE 1
Figure BDA0003402686070000071
Figure BDA0003402686070000081
The results show that: the oil-in-water type skin care lotion of the present invention has excellent physical and chemical stability regardless of accelerated tests or long-term tests.
Test example 2
The oil-in-water type skin care emulsion of the invention is subjected to sanitary microorganism inspection and sanitary chemical inspection
The results of the sanitary microbiological examination and the sanitary chemical examination of the skin care cream prepared in example 1 of the present invention are shown in table 2.
TABLE 2
Figure BDA0003402686070000091
The results of the sanitary microbiological examination and the sanitary chemical examination of the skin care milks of examples 2 to 6 were not significantly different from those of example 1.
The results show that: the oil-in-water skin care emulsion meets the regulation of technical standards for cosmetic safety.
Test example 3
The feeling of use of the oil-in-water skin care milk of the present invention was evaluated.
Randomly selecting 30 subjects, cleaning face for 5min, applying 2 pumps of the oil-in-water skin care milk prepared in the invention in the embodiment 1, the embodiment 6 and the comparative example 4 on the face, filling in questionnaire after 30min, and counting to obtain the results shown in the table 3.
TABLE 3
Figure BDA0003402686070000092
Figure BDA0003402686070000101
The results show that: the texture, touch and skin feel of the oil-in-water skin care emulsion of example 1 are more satisfactory to consumers than those of example 6 and comparative example 4.
